Washtenaw Sheriff Clayton Views Capitol Assault As 'Emblematic' Of America's Racist History

Jerry Clayton
Washtenaw County Sheriff
/
washtenaw.org

Thousands of Trump supporters stormed the U.S. Capitol Building Wednesday as Congress worked to certify Joe Biden's victory in the 2020 presidential election.  Washtenaw County Sheriff Jerry Clayton Joined WEMU's David Fair to share his thoughts on the racist motivations behind the insurrection and the police response to the mob attack.
